Dry Stone Walling

Description

Mr. Tom Varley laying the first throughs across a dry stone wall at the height of around two feet from the ground, to bind the two wall faces together ( Ribblesdale). He is repairing a large gap in an old wall with stones available from the collapsed section. Mounted on Photo File card with LAVC/PHO/P0946. With typed note. Card 1 in a series of 5.
